2024 General Election
ResultLab Hold
Election date4 Jul 2024
Turnout38,887
Majority7,944
| Candidate | Party | Votes | Share |
|---|---|---|---|
| Seema Malhotra | Labour | 16,139 | 41.5% |
| Reva Gudi | Conservative | 8,195 | 21.1% |
| Prabhdeep Singh | Reform UK | 5,130 | 13.2% |
| Katherine Kandelaki | Green Party | 2,543 | 6.5% |
| Amritpal Singh Mann | Workers Party of Britain | 2,201 | 5.7% |
| Dhruv Sengupta | Liberal Democrat | 1,821 | 4.7% |
| Abdul Majid Tramboo | Independent | 1,658 | 4.3% |
| Ian Christopher Brown | Independent | 454 | 1.2% |
| Aysha Siddika Choudhury | Independent | 373 | 1.0% |
| Damian Read | Independent | 373 | 1.0% |
